From: Jo-Philipp Wich Date: Thu, 30 Jul 2009 03:31:19 +0000 (+0000) Subject: luci-0.9: merge r5168 X-Git-Tag: 0.9.0~145 X-Git-Url: http://207.154.207.93/?a=commitdiff_plain;h=afc80c0bef1afbc178973d0c3e3ca53fee758da7;p=project%2Fluci.git luci-0.9: merge r5168 --- diff --git a/libs/lmo/src/lmo_core.c b/libs/lmo/src/lmo_core.c index 0754d0dc5..f9e533130 100644 --- a/libs/lmo/src/lmo_core.c +++ b/libs/lmo/src/lmo_core.c @@ -74,7 +74,7 @@ lmo_archive_t * lmo_open(const char *file) goto cleanup; } - if( lseek(in, -sizeof(uint32_t), SEEK_END) == -1 ) + if( lseek(in, (off_t)(-sizeof(uint32_t)), SEEK_END) == -1 ) { error("Can not seek to eof", 1); goto cleanup; @@ -86,7 +86,7 @@ lmo_archive_t * lmo_open(const char *file) goto cleanup; } - if( lseek(in, idx_offset, SEEK_SET) == -1 ) + if( lseek(in, (off_t)idx_offset, SEEK_SET) == -1 ) { error("Can not seek to index offset", 1); goto cleanup;